Many outdoor smart device owners overlook an essential security setting that can leave their devices vulnerable to hacking or unauthorized access. That setting is often related to device encryption and the importance of timely firmware updates. While you might focus on the device’s features or how it fits into your outdoor space, neglecting these security measures can open the door to potential threats. Encryption acts as a digital shield, scrambling the data transmitted between your device and your network so that even if someone intercepts it, they can’t decipher what’s being shared. Without proper encryption, hackers can eavesdrop on sensitive information or even manipulate your device’s functions.

Many outdoor devices lack proper encryption, risking hacking and unauthorized access. Prioritize security to protect your data and privacy.

You might not realize that many outdoor smart devices—like security cameras, smart lights, or weather stations—come with default security settings that are inadequate for real-world threats. These default settings often lack strong device encryption, leaving your data exposed. It’s essential to check your device’s security options and ensure encryption is enabled. Doing so reduces the risk of unauthorized access and keeps your private information safe. But encryption alone isn’t enough. Firmware updates play a significant role in maintaining your device’s security. Manufacturers regularly release firmware updates to patch vulnerabilities that cybercriminals could exploit. If you ignore these updates, your device remains susceptible to known security flaws. Regular firmware updates are crucial for addressing emerging threats and ensuring your device stays protected. Many device owners delay or forget to install firmware updates, thinking they’re unnecessary or too complicated. In reality, these updates are necessary for keeping your device secure. They often include patches for security flaws, improvements to device encryption protocols, and enhanced overall stability. Failing to update your firmware leaves your device running outdated software that hackers can easily target. To stay protected, you should regularly check for updates and install them promptly. Some devices can automatically update, but if yours doesn’t, setting a routine to verify firmware versions once a month can make a big difference. Regular security maintenance is an essential part of safeguarding your outdoor devices against evolving cyber threats.

How Often Should I Update My Outdoor Smart Device’s Firmware for Security?

You should update your outdoor smart device’s firmware as soon as security patches are released, ideally monthly or whenever a critical update is available. Regular firmware updates help fix vulnerabilities and improve security. Keep an eye on notifications from the device manufacturer or check the app regularly. By staying current with firmware updates, you safeguard your device from potential threats and guarantee it operates smoothly and securely.
